How to fix?

Upgrade github.com/go-gitea/gitea/modules/private to version 1.27.0 or higher.

Overview

Affected versions of this package are vulnerable to Improper Certificate Validation due to the internal API HTTP client hardcoding InsecureSkipVerify to true in the TLS configuration, which disables certificate validation for outbound HTTPS connections. An attacker can intercept internal API requests and capture the high-privilege authentication token by performing a man-in-the-middle attack on the internal network segment.

Note: This is only exploitable if internal communication is configured over HTTPS to a non-loopback target in a split-host or multi-pod deployment.
